ABSTRACT This invention concerns a method and feed composition for improving nutritional response in ruminating animals. The method comprises orally administering to a ruminating animal malic acid. The feed composition comprises an edible carrier for ruminating animals and malic acid. Malic acid has been found to be useful for improving growth response, milk production, and feed efficiency in ruminating animals.
